In the riveting opening of "The Murder of Merlin," the stakes are set high as the world teeters on the edge of chaos. The narrative plunges into a dark mystery surrounding one of the most formidable figures in mythology. The Demon Knights are drawn into a tangled web where trust is fleeting, and danger lurks at every turn.
As they navigate treacherous alliances and hidden agendas, the group must grapple with the question of who possesses the audacity—and the ability—to bring down such a legendary figure. With richly illustrated panels, each character's depth unfolds as personal motivations become a focal point of the story.
Against a backdrop of magical realism and a growing sense of dread, the tale weaves a complex tapestry of betrayal, heroism, and dark enchantments. The suspense builds with each page, leaving readers eager to uncover the truth behind Merlin's impending doom.
